RAIL services were disrupted after a fire near the line at Stratford stopped trains on the London to Norwich line.

The blaze in a van broke out near gas cylinders, so a 200m exclusion zone, including the railway line, was cordoned off by police at 2.40am yesterday .

Kerry Howard, spokeswoman for Anglia Railways said trains from Norwich had to stop at Stratford instead of reaching Liverpool Street.

Two of the company's four lines into Liverpool Street were reopened at 11am yesterday.

She said: "The first train which got into Liverpool Street was the 10am service from Norwich, and the first one out of Liverpool Street was the 12.30pm."
